## Configuration

Heya — if you're on call and Pickaroo (our warehouse pick-list optimizer) starts acting up, config is the first place to look. Everything lives in `.env` on the batcher host. `PICKAROO_WAVE_SIZE` controls how many orders get bundled per wave, and `PICKAROO_AISLE_MAP` points at the Brindlewick floor layout file. The solver also talks to the routing service, which requires auth on every call, so make sure the following line is present in the file.

vault entry, yahif-yajep: COURIER_KEY29=b802bdf8034096b65a51c6ba5abe2

## Break-Glass: CSV Import Wizard

Welcome aboard! If the ImportWiz queue at Brambleford Systems jams and nobody senior is around, you can use break-glass access to flush stuck CSV jobs. Only do this if row validation has fully stalled — ping the Tooling channel first. To unlock the emergency console, use the recovery passphrase below.

strongbox words: alddor-rusius-belox-gorys-holius-oliix-ralmir-lamvan-briius-fraion-zormir-novwyn-zormir-holmir

## Onboarding: the Skeinworks schema registry

All events your plugin emits must have a schema registered with Skeinworks before publish; unregistered events are dropped at the gateway. Compatibility checks run on every registration, and breaking changes are rejected. Your plugin authenticates to the registry using a credential set in its env file. Place the following line under SCHEMA_REGISTRY_URL:

env line for fafof-fahag: LEDGER_TOKEN5=f8790

Subject: Quickstore 4.2 — bloom filter now fronts the KV layer

Plugin authors: starting with this release, Quickstore places a bloom filter ahead of the key-value store. Negative lookups return faster; false positives fall through safely. No API changes are required on your side. Verify your plugin against the staging build referenced below.

session token of fahif-tadup = htk3_9c7